Crystal Structure of KRAS-G12V (GMPPNP-bound) in complex with RAS-binding domain (RBD) and cysteine-rich domain (CRD) of RAF1/CRAF
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| APS BEAMLINE 24-ID-C |
Synchrotron site | APS |
Beamline | 24-ID-C |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2018-12-09 |
Detector | DECTRIS PILATUS 6M-F |
Wavelength(s) | 0.9791 |
Spacegroup name | P 6 2 2 |
Unit cell lengths | 132.100, 132.100, 90.170 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 48.300 - 2.870 |
R-factor | 0.2219 |
Rwork | 0.217 |
R-free | 0.26910 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| KRAS:RAF1-RBDCRD (crystal form II) |
Data reduction software | XDS |
Data scaling software | SCALA |
Phasing software | PHASER |
Refinement software | PHENIX (1.17.1_3660)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 48.300 | 2.970 |
High resolution limit [Å] | 2.870 | 2.870 |
Rmerge | 0.071 | 0.885 |
Rmeas | 0.079 | 0.965 |
Number of reflections | 10931 | 1720 |
<I/σ(I)> | 16.04 | 2.53 |
Completeness [%] | 98.5 | 99.7 |
Redundancy | 5.8 | 6.2 |
CC(1/2) | 0.998 | 0.827 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 6.5 | 293 | 100 mM sodium cacodylate pH 6.5, 200 mM MgCl2, 8% PGA, 0.35 mM D-myo-phosphatidylinositol 3,4,5-triphosphate |
